首页 > 系统相关 >父进程对子进程不进行回收,让系统去回收,线程也一样

父进程对子进程不进行回收,让系统去回收,线程也一样

时间:2023-02-25 23:14:09浏览次数:30  
标签:操作系统 回收 线程 pthread 进程 对子

在父进程中,使用下面函数以后,父进程对子进程不进行回收,让操作系统去回收

signal(SIGCHLD,SIG_IGN);

如果主线程对子线程,不进行回收的时候,采用子线程和主线程分离,分离以后由操作系统去回收

pthread_detach(pthread_self());

标签:操作系统,回收,线程,pthread,进程,对子
From: https://www.cnblogs.com/miwaiwai/p/17155673.html

相关文章

  • QT多线程实现冒泡排序和快速排序方法一
    qt4的线程方式#include"mythread.h"#include<QElapsedTimer>#include<QDebug>Generate::Generate(QObject*parent):QThread(parent){}voidGenerate::recvNum(intnum......
  • qt多线程实现快速排序和冒泡排序方法二
    qt5多线程处理方式#include"mainwindow.h"#include"ui_mainwindow.h"#include"mythread.h"#include<QThread>MainWindow::MainWindow(QWidget*parent):QMainWindo......
  • Windows黑客编程之进程隐藏
    描述通过hookZwQuerySystemInformation函数,改变其返回值结果,在taskmanager、procexp等进程管理器内隐藏目标进程知识点dll注入:通过在prcexp等进程内注入dll,执行代......
  • Java学习之多线程
    线程的三种创建线程Threadclass:继承实现线程类(不建议使用)Runnable接口:实现接口(推荐使用,避免单继承局限性)Callable接口:实现接口(了解)ThreadClass实现方式......
  • 半同步/半反应堆线程池
    介绍异步线程只有一个,由主线程充当,它负责监听所有socket上的事件如果监听socket上发生读事件(有新的连接请求到来),主线程就接受得到新的连接socket,然后往epoll内核......
  • 计算机操作系统--进程
                                        ......
  • Windows黑客编程之进程篡改
    描述向目标进程中注入shellcode并跳转运行,披着安全进程的外皮执行恶意代码代码调用写了一段弹窗的shellcode,需要用汇编写功能,再转化为机器码#include"stdafx.h"......
  • 线程同步机制的封装
    #ifndefLOCKER_H#defineLOCKER_H#include<pthread.h>#include<semaphore.h>#include<exception>//封装信号量classsem{public:sem(){......
  • 强行在CentOS上kill python进程 unix:///tmp/supervisor.sock
    问题:unix:///tmp/supervisor.sock解决方案:echo_supervisord_conf>/etc/supervisord.confsudosupervisord-c/etc/supervisord.confsudosupervisorctlstatus​​https:......
  • Sword 进程间传递打开的文件描述符(API介绍)
    头文件#include<sys/socket.h>函数intsocketpair(intdomain,inttype,intprotocol,intsocket_vector[2]);​函数建立一对匿名的已经连接的套接字,其特性由......